  Hi Terry. The Advent 4211 comes with XP HOme with 1GB of RAM and it has a 10 
inch display. This machine has 80GB hard drive space and will run Jaws and 
System Access. I can't speak for other screen readers but I'm quite sure it 
wouldn't be a problem to run other screen readers.
